E4:

E4 is a huge British television channel, they were set up in January 2001 to go along side channel 4. There are a range of programmes you can watch from reality TV shows, sitcoms and dramas. It is mainly aimed at people from the ages 15 to 35. They broadcast a variety of american programmes, from Big Bang Theory to 90210.  The actors that star in the programs are aged around the same as the target audience. This makes it easier for us to relate to the characters. Also as they use some real life situations within the story lines it again help us connect to the characters, therefore making the program more enjoyable and interesting. As films and music have evolved so have to types of programmes E4 broadcast. For example, theres is a lot more rap music being listened to by the younger generation. This led to the production of 'Youngers', a series about a group of friends who are braking into the industry.






During adverts E4 use a lot of idents to promote there logo. Each ident has the logo incorporated into it, however they are done in many different ways. The latest ident stars 'Eefer' the E4 robot. In this ident the robot is the E4 logo and keeps the signature purple colour. It shows the robot doing everyday tasks like going to the cafe, this relates to us the viewer as it is something many of us do on a regular bases. He is portrayed to be like a human, and even has his dog waiting outside for him. It is more interesting and humorous because he is a robot. The people in the ident do not react to him and treat the situation like it is normal. I believe this relates to the older side of the target audience as they are most likely to go into a cafe to get there daily caffeine fix.






This ident features a hotel room. The room slowly begins to come to life with various strange and unusual things happening. It plays on the idea that when we leave rooms they come to life. This could show how E4 will bring your television to life through the different programs. It creates a surreal setting that attracts the viewers attention. By having it set up in a hotel room it links to there target audience, however by using this idea it can also relate to our childhoods.





BBC3 IDENT:

 (2014)
This ident uses a lot of colour to attract the viewer. It keeps the colour theme through out the ident, which links to the colour of the BBC3 logo.  It portrays BBC3 to be a very appealing and glamorous channel. It reminds us of nightclub lights, very bright and in your face. This can link to their target audience, 16-25 year olds as they are the majority age group that would go to a club.  







 (2010)
In 2010 the idents were very different. They did not have the signature purply,pink colour. This meant the idents were a lot duller. However they used comedy to attract people. They used small animated figures to create different scenes. In this ident they are singing a song. The song says' Three is a magic number' emphasising that channel 3 is great channel. By using humour it relates to the genre of the channel. Although they do broadcast some series documentaries and also show films, the majority of the programmes they show are comedies. Thus portraying BBC3 as a hilarious channel before even watching the programmes.
